Analysis

In 2021, ratio of inbound to outbound tourists in Sierra Leone stood at 1.6.

The figure is up 153.3% on the previous year and up 204.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, ratio of inbound to outbound tourists in Sierra Leone peaked at 2.93 in 2003 and was at its lowest, 0.3934, in 2015.

Sierra Leone ranks 42nd of 105 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
